Compare Torrance to Casa de Oro-Mount Helix

This post compares Torrance, California to Casa de Oro-Mount Helix,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Torrance (city) Casa de Oro-Mount Helix (CDP)
Population 147,190 20,196
Income (median) $66,475 $62,815
Home Value (median) $687,900 $623,500
White 49% 81%
Black 2% 5%
Asian 35% 2%
With Kids 31% 34%
Age (median) 41 44
Rentals 45% 28%
